Myers Industries, Inc. (NYSE: MYE), Akron, OH, reported sales for the third quarter of $197.3 million, an increase of 3.7 percent over the same period a year ago. Profit fell 19.7 percent for the polymer products manufacturer to $5.8 million.

Strong sales performance in the Engineered Products Segment combined with a sales increase in the Material Handling Segment more than offset a sales decrease in the Distribution Segment. Sales for the Distribution Segment were $45.1 million in the third quarter, 7.6 percent lower than the prior year.
For the first nine months, sales were $577.2 million, a 2.5 percent increase year-over-year. Profit rose 15.3 percent to $21.4 million.
